Gardai in Tuam are on the look out for thieves who have been targeting religious statues over the last number of weeks. Two religious statues have been stolen in the past three weeks from grottos, leaving gardai baffled. This is the second time in the past number of months that religious statues have been targeted in the Tuam area. In September 2009, a Marian statue was destroyed at the roadside grotto on the N17 at Miltown. And, the Marion Grotto at Milltown has once again been hit, with thieves making off with the replacement statue. Just two weeks ago, a statue of the Virgin Mary was taken from the year-old grotto in the grounds of the church in Abbeyknockmoy. A second statue in the grotto of St Bernadette was left untouched. "We have no definite leads on these thefts at the moment, but a full investigation is ongoing. We are still appealing to the public to come forward with any information on either theft," said Sgt Martin Connor of Tuam Gardai. |
